Western Wyoming Community College
Western Wyoming Community College, located in Rock Springs, serves the energy-rich southwest Wyoming region with associate, certificate, and bachelor's-completion programs. The college offers strong computing programs in computer science, software development, cybersecurity, and information systems, along with business degrees including bachelor's-level industrial and organizational management options. Engineering and pre-engineering transfer tracks prepare students for four-year STEM degrees, while natural sciences and GIS programs align with the region's energy and environmental industries. Trades programs in welding, automotive technology, diesel technology, and electrical technology serve the workforce needs of Sweetwater County's oil, gas, and trona mining industries. The college's Industrial Management BAS completion program is designed for working adults seeking advancement in supervisory and operations roles.
